8f44bd6426 fix(ollama): emit streaming events for text content during generation (#53891)
The Ollama stream function requested `stream: true` from the API but
accumulated all content chunks internally, emitting only a single `done`
event at the end. This prevented downstream consumers (block streaming
pipeline, typing indicators, draft stream) from receiving incremental
text updates during generation.

Emit the full `start → text_start → text_delta* → text_end → done`
event sequence matching the AssistantMessageEvent contract used by
Anthropic, OpenAI, and Google providers. Each `text_delta` carries both
the incremental `delta` and an accumulated `partial` snapshot.

Tool-call-only responses (no text content) continue to emit only the
`done` event, preserving backward compatibility.

6ade9c474c feat(hooks): add async requireApproval to before_tool_call (#55339)
* Plugins: add native ask dialog for before_tool_call hooks

Extend the before_tool_call plugin hook with a requireApproval return field
that pauses agent execution and waits for real user approval via channels
(Telegram, Discord, /approve command) instead of relying on the agent to
cooperate with a soft block.

- Add requireApproval field to PluginHookBeforeToolCallResult with id, title,
  description, severity, timeout, and timeoutBehavior options
- Extend runModifyingHook merge callback to receive hook registration so
  mergers can stamp pluginId; always invoke merger even for the first result
- Make ExecApprovalManager generic so it can be reused for plugin approvals
- Add plugin.approval.request/waitDecision/resolve gateway methods with
  schemas, scope guards, and broadcast events
- Handle requireApproval in pi-tools via two-phase gateway RPC with fallback
  to soft block when the gateway is unavailable
- Extend the exec approval forwarder with plugin approval message builders
  and forwarding methods
- Update /approve command to fall back to plugin.approval.resolve when exec
  approval lookup fails
- Document before_tool_call requireApproval in hooks docs and unified
  /approve behavior in exec-approvals docs

* fix: harden plugin approval hook reliability

- Add APPROVAL_NOT_FOUND error code so /approve fallback uses structured
  matching instead of fragile string comparison
- Check block before requireApproval so higher-priority plugin blocks
  cannot be overridden by a lower-priority approval
- Race waitDecision against abort signal so users are not stuck waiting
  for the full approval timeout after cancelling a run
- Use null consistently for missing pluginDescription instead of
  converting to undefined
- Add comments explaining the +10s timeout buffer on gateway RPCs

* docs: document block > requireApproval precedence in hooks

* fix: address Phase 1 critical correctness issues for plugin approval hooks

- Fix timeout-allow param bug: return merged hook params instead of
  original params when timeoutBehavior is "allow", preventing security
  plugins from having their parameter rewrites silently discarded.

- Host-generate approval IDs: remove plugin-provided id field from the
  requireApproval type, gateway request, and protocol schema. Server
  always generates IDs via randomUUID() to prevent forged/predictable
  ID attacks.

- Define onResolution semantics: add PluginApprovalResolutions constants
  and PluginApprovalResolution type. onResolution callback now fires on
  every exit path (allow, deny, timeout, abort, gateway error, no-ID).
  Decision branching uses constants instead of hard-coded strings.

- Fix pre-existing test infrastructure issues: bypass CJS mock cache for
  getGlobalHookRunner global singleton, reset gateway mock between tests,
  fix hook merger priority ordering in block+requireApproval test.

* fix: tighten plugin approval schema and add kind-prefixed IDs

Harden the plugin approval request schema: restrict severity to
enum (info|warning|critical), cap timeoutMs at 600s, limit title
to 80 chars and description to 256 chars. Prefix plugin approval
IDs with `plugin:` so /approve routing can distinguish them from
exec approvals deterministically instead of relying on fallback.
